Compliance Case Studies

Suffolk Construction image
SUFFOLK CONSTRUCTION

Implemented ALICE AI platform to analyze schedules, adjust sequencing, and optimize milestones on life sciences project amid procurement delays.

Recovered 42 days, eliminated negative float.
Andrade Gutierrez image
ANDRADE GUTIERREZ

Used ALICE Optimize for scheduling on critical infrastructure project in South America to overcome delays and enhance crew utilization.

Saved time and costs through optimized utilization.
Hawaiian Dredging Construction Company image
HAWAIIAN DREDGING CONSTRUCTION COMPANY

Applied ALICE AI for site logistics and equipment management on mixed-use project built on constrained urban parking lot site.

Improved efficiency in tight space maneuvering.
AF Gruppen image
AF GRUPPEN

Leveraged ALICE platform to test crew and material variations on residential mid-rise project in Norway for schedule improvements.

Enhanced duration and profitability analysis.

What are some industry-specific use cases for AI in construction?
  • AI optimizes project scheduling through predictive analytics and machine learning.
  • It aids in risk assessment by analyzing historical project data for insights.
  • Construction safety can be enhanced with AI-driven monitoring and reporting tools.
  • Resource allocation can be optimized through AI-based workload analysis.
  • AI improves quality control by detecting construction defects at early stages.
